Welcome aboard! The Quellbird deduplicator collapses repeat alerts within a 10-minute window, keyed on service and error class. If on-call folks report duplicate pages, first check whether the window config got reset to zero — happens more than you'd think. Restarting the worker pool usually clears stuck batches. Full triage steps live on the internal page linked below.

wiki page, hahif-hahif: https://argocd.kelvisys.corp/browse/board/settings/pages/1442e0b1065d83f1

Handover for the weekly eng sync: I'm transferring ownership of Duskrunner, our nightly backfill scheduler, to Priya. Current state: all jobs healthy except the ledger-reconciliation backfill, which retries once nightly due to a slow upstream from the Kestwick warehouse. Retry logic, window sizing, and concurrency caps were all tuned carefully last quarter — please don't change them without a load test. For full transparency at the sync, the production instance runs with these configuration values.

settings of hawep-kadug:
RALAEL_HOST=ralael.tolvaqlabs.internal
RALAEL_PORT=9000

## Further Reading

Clock skew between Fernwick build agents has caused nondeterministic cache invalidation and spurious "stale artifact" failures, so reviewers should not assume timestamps from different agents are comparable. The Harbinder pool syncs via our internal time service, but drift up to 400ms has been observed under load. For the measurement methodology, historical drift charts, and mitigation notes, see the internal page below.

operations page: https://jenkins.zemvarcloud.local/job/merge_requests/repo/build/73930b4b30f0a8ed

- [ ] Step 7: Archive cold storage buckets (Glacierline tier). Confirm both ceremony witnesses are present, verify bucket manifests match the Oxbow ledger, then seal the archive key shares. Plugin authors may observe but not handle shares. Once sealed, the archive index itself is encrypted and can only be reopened with the passphrase below.

vault phrase of badup-hahig = tamael-aldael-kelmir-istael-fenok-istwyn-tamius-jorath-oliion